TRUTH

You know me, God
And you love me, still?
You say forever you will
Though you know my words before I speak them
My thoughts before I think them
My praises to you, before I sing them
My sins, before I commit them
And you love me, still?

The pieces of me that I hide
The pieces in which I take pride
My greed and my ambition
My trouble with submission
The thoughts that are unkind
The idols I’ve enshrined
Every piece of me - you know them
And you love me, still?

I’ve tried to run so many times
Either with my feet or in my mind
Thinking it’s you I had to leave behind
Realising it’s me, it’s been me all this time
Realising it too late sometimes
After the hurt, and the rage
And someone else’s pain
Surely by now it’s all too late
But you remain, always the same
And you love me, still.
